2305 W Howard Ln Austin, Texas 78728 United States
Your reliable towing company in Austin.
2305 W Howard Ln Austin, Texas 78728 United States
2305 W Howard Ln Austin, Texas 78728 United States
reliable source for wrecker and towing services
Listings » Business & Professional Services » Business Coaching
2305 W Howard Ln Austin, Texas 78728 United States
2305 W Howard Ln Austin, Texas 78728 United States
2305 W Howard Ln Austin, Texas 78728 United States
Austin Truck Towing Service
2025 Guadalupe Street, University of Texas at Austin Austin, Texas 78705 United States
Web Design Services
2025 Guadalupe St #260 Austin, Texas 78705 United States
SEO Services, Web Design Services, Web Design
2025 Guadalupe St #260, Austin, Texas 78705 United States
SEO Company, Web Design Services & PPC
1825 Samuel Morse Dr Herndon, Virginia 20190 United States